Description
This report provides the court in Colorado with essential information about training evaluation with which to create an effective system for evaluating the training component of the Court Improvement Program (CIP). It is important to acknowledge here the differences in cultures between the various stakeholders that make up the audience for this multi-disciplinary training. The approaches to evaluation described here are the ideal for measuring effectiveness of training in the child welfare arena.
